A leaked video from the set of Avengers: Doomsday has taken the internet by storm, just days after the Russo Brothers confirmed that filming is officially underway — with Robert Downey Jr. returning in the powerful new role of Victor Von Doom.
The brief video clip, which surfaced on social media late Monday night, shows a mystery actor dressed in a grey suit, carrying a briefcase, walking toward a suburban-style house. The actor opens the door, enters, and closes it behind him. While the scene appears simple, the lack of a clear view of the actor’s face has ignited a frenzy of speculation among fans.
Many believe the figure could be Robert Downey Jr., shooting his much-anticipated scenes as the iconic supervillain Doctor Doom. However, others suggest the actor may be someone else entirely, potentially teasing a surprise casting.
Fueling further speculation, one tweet floated the theory that actor Julian McMahon — who previously portrayed Doctor Doom in the Fantastic Four films — could be making a return to the Marvel Cinematic Universe as a variant of the character. According to this theory, McMahon’s version may not be a villain, making room for Downey Jr. to embody the darker, central version of Doctor Doom.
On Instagram, the Russo Brothers, who will direct the MCU's next two Avengers movies, shared the first set photo to announce that filming has finally started. While the picture doesn't reveal details from the film, it shows a chair with the name Victor Von Doom.
Avengers: Doomsday is slated for a May 1, 2026 release. The film will likely be set after the events of 'The Fantastic Four: First Steps' which is slated to hit theatres on 25 June 2025.
